         <description><![CDATA[<div>How do we feel about this idea from 1959? Is Hansberry's message still valid?<br>&nbsp; &nbsp;I believe this message is still valid even 64 years later. People losing hope and not achieving dreams is a timeless thing. When Walter says, " I'm thirty-five years old; I been married eleven years and I got a boy who sleeps in the living room- and all I've got to give him is stories about how rich white people live..." shows that he is only 35 which is pretty early in his life still and he has already given up. However he is a little different that Big Walter and Mama because he is trying to reignite his dream but there is another road block, poverty. It is very hard to achieve your dreams with no money and especially hard for a person of color on top of have very little money. Even today poverty is a big obstacle and is seen as impossible by some so they get easily discouraged. The message that Hansberry is trying to convey is nothing but truth and I bet that was hard for people both in 1959 and 2023. I don't know how the book ends but maybe it can be seen as motivation to not lose hope. That sounds stupid but I don't know.<br><br>Where does this fit in the plot? What's happening?&nbsp;<br>   When Walter says this it is the day before the Younger family gets the life insurance from Big Walter's death. Walter wants to use the money for investing in his liquor shop while Beneatha wants Mama to use it for what she wants but deep down wants to use it for medical school. Mama however doesn't know what to do with it. The questions we had to answer about what we would do if we got money from a loved one's death is tying directly into the book. Even the options we were given is what the Younger family is dealing with. I imagine later in the plot they will be figuring out what to do with the money.</div>]]></description>
